Halloween frights, fun and candy at Rideau Hall

By OttawaMatters Staff

The Governor General's residence will be a spooky place, Thursday evening, as staff come back from the dead to welcome trick-or-treaters.

Rideau Hall's annual Halloween celebration — this year, dubbed “Dinner with the Dead” — includes new activities.

Staff will take trick-or-treaters through the creepy kitchen, and they can get a photo at the haunted dinner table filled with creepy and weird foods. Canada Agriculture and Food Museum staff will be on hand to help children learn about what is in soil, and help them identify animals by their skeletons.

Rideau Hall staff will be on hand to distribute goodies to trick-or-treaters of all ages.

The event runs from 5 to 8 p.m., Thursday, at Rideau Hall. Attendees can enter from Thomas Gate on Sussex Drive, and street parking is available in the neighbourhood.
